This is the protocol for a Campbell systematic review. The objectives are as follows. The objective of this review is to identify and synthesize empirical research on the impacts of interest-holder engagement on the guideline development process and content. Our research questions are as follows: (1) What are the empirical examples of impact on the process in health guideline development across any of the 18 steps of the GIN-McMaster checklist? (2) What are the empirical examples of impact on the content in health guideline development across any of the 18 steps of the GIN-McMaster checklist?
